Full Job Description
This is a challenging strategic sales management position leading a regional sales team and reporting directly to the EVP of Sales, Service, Support for Americas. In this role you will be responsible for managing the sales relationship for your team's accounts including Key Global Accounts. This includes developing executive relationships, ensuring your team's execution from Q2C, achieving synergy with global business partners including Business Units, Applications support, sales, marketing and numerous functional partners both regionally and globally. Candidate must be able to provide guidance and leadership to their team enabling them to continuously achieve forecast targets, maximize growth, revenue and profit. Key Responsibilities include: - Develop and manage relationships with customers, executives, functional partners both internal and external with ability to influence decisions - Influence cross-functional relationship building and project management skills - Develop sales plans, including account strategies, local/downstream resource allocation, define product deficiencies/issues, manage benchmarks, and make appropriate product and engagement decisions as it affects the account globally - Drive sales using a consultative approach through understanding the customer's business, goals and organizational dynamics, then defining the most compelling solution based on Advantest's offerings - Creating value propositions with technical and marketing teams - Driving accuracy of forecasting and revenue targets - Manage and prioritize resource allocations and escalations - Drive executive alignment, engagement and governance including accountability for deliverables and sales metrics Minimum Required Skills: - 5+ years of experience in managing sales team, - 15+ years of experience in customer support role - 15+ years of experience in technology - Strong business acumen and negotiation abilities - Strong proven leadership and communication skills - Proven track record driving global customer teams by achieving sales targets, market share goals and high customer satisfaction - Ability to lead and influence remote teams - Ability to present, influence and drive change at an executive level - Combined experience in business, field sales, applications, engineering, marketing, business development or global strategic account management in the semiconductor capital equipment industry - BS in Business or Engineering preferred
